To maintain the correct environment for your fish, bacteria and plants to stay healthy and thrive, the grower needs to be constantly aware of certain parameter levels. Three critical indicators of aquaponics water quality are pH (acid or alkaline level), temperature and electrical conductivity or EC (level of nutrient).
